如何使用批处理停止php服务器? (批处理停止php服务器)

如何使用批处理停止PHP服务器?

在进行PHP开发过程中,经常需要搭建一个本地开发环境来进行测试和调试。在这个过程中,很多人都选择使用WAMP或者XAMPP一类的工具来快速地搭建一个本地的WEB服务。

不过,在使用这些工具的时候,有的时候我们需要快速地停止这个WEB服务。这个时候,使用批处理文件就能极大地方便我们的工作。

下面,我们来一步步学习如何使用批处理停止PHP服务器。

之一步:创建批处理文件

我们需要打开一个文本编辑器,比如记事本,然后在空白的区域里输入以下代码:

net stop wampapache

net stop wampmysqld

这两行代码的作用分别是停止Apache和MySQL服务。根据您所使用的WEB服务,修改上述代码的服务名称即可。

第二步:保存批处理文件

在输入完代码之后,我们需要将这段代码存储为批处理文件,以方便我们后续运行。为了保存批处理文件,请按下键盘上的“Ctrl+S”组合键,然后在保存类型中选择“所有文件(*.*)”,文件名为“stop.bat”,最后点击“保存”按钮即可。

第三步:运行批处理文件

当我们需要停止PHP服务器的时候,只需要双击我们刚刚创建的“stop.bat”文件,即可快速地停止WEB服务。在执行批处理文件的时候,会有一个黑色的命令行窗口弹出来,这个窗口会显示执行命令的详细过程。

使用批处理文件可以极大地方便我们的工作,它可以对多个命令进行批量执行,从而提高工作效率。在PHP开发环境中,使用批处理文件来停止WEB服务,既方便又快速,特别是对于那些没有GUI界面或者只能通过命令行进行操作的系统来说,更是一个方便的选择。

相关问题拓展阅读:

php函数问题 如何停止ignore_user_abort();

在200次的时候在for循环中加入break就停止for循环了啊

用break可以跳出循环,至于什么条件看你自己写

你试试就知道了 记得加入 set_time_limit or ignore_user_abort 看祥局效果腊宴坦

$i=0;

while(true){

if(!file_exists(‘轮桐数据库.txt’)) break;

file_put_contents(‘test.txt’,$i);

$i++;

sleep(1);

}

php怎么使用服务器的批量处理bat文件

php执行批斗银处肢顷理文件空饥宴函数有:exec ,system 等;

使用实例:

php在执行bat脚本时,一直阻塞,如何解决

exec 或者 system 都可以调用cmd 的命令

直接上代码:

复制代码代码如下:

虽然你已歼仔毁经问了很久了 。今天我戚镇也碰到这个问题了。

发现是session死锁造成的 。

你可以在执行bat脚本的时候吧session关闭

session_write_close();

这样就不会阻塞下次请氏备求了。不过如果你想执行完写入session那就不行了

关于批处理停止php服务器的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 如何使用批处理停止php服务器? (批处理停止php服务器)